Trinidad and Tobago — World Gazetteer, 2005 edition

Trinidad and Tobago had an estimated population of 1,310,615 in 2005, with 22 places recorded. Archived from the World Gazetteer, the reference work formerly published at this domain.

Cities and towns, 2005

#PlaceRegionPopulation (2005)
1ChaguanasChaguanas72,159
2San JuanSan Juan-Laventville56,588
3San FernandoSan Fernando56,380
4Port of SpainPort of Spain49,657
5ArimaArima34,997
6MarabellaPrinces Town26,700
7Point FortínPoint Fortín18,917
8TunapunaTunapuna-Piarco17,758
9Sangre GrandeSangre Grande15,968
10TacariguaTunapuna-Piarco15,067
11AroucaTunapuna-Piarco12,054
12Princes TownPrinces Town11,000
13SipariaSiparia8,568
14CouvaCouva-Tabaquite-Talparo5,178
15Saint JosephSan Juan-Laventville4,904
16PeñalPeñal Débé4,899
17ScarboroughTobago4,595
18MucurapoDiego Martín4,342
19TabaquiteCouva-Tabaquite-Talparo3,314
20DébéPeñal Débé3,127
21BicheSangre Grande2,844
22Rio ClaroMayaro-Río Claro2,808
